    You're not out of luck! There's plenty of solutions, for significantly less than $100-200 as well!

    There's the Roku streaming device: (you need an account to see links)
    Amazon Fire Stick: (you need an account to see links)
    Google Chromecast: (you need an account to see links)

    Any of these would work perfectly for Netflix/Hulu/etc. I personally have owned a Roku and a Fire Stick. I prefer the Fire Stick, because of it's integration to Amazon's ecosystem. If you have any questions feel free to ask!

    I HIGHLY recommend the Nvidia Shield TV. It has netflix, amazon, and hulu. You can also download kodi to it from the google play store which works amazingly. Best part is you can stream all your Steam games to it, it's a pretty powerful gaming machine also.

    Heres a link: (you need an account to see links)


    can probably find a cheaper one on ebay. Managed to snag mine for $150 on black friday when it first came out

    the firestick is cheap because it's not very powerful. it's good for streaming netflix/amazon but you'll have trouble with anything else such as kodi. if you're going to go for an amazon device I'd recommend the Amazon Fire TV: (you need an account to see links)

    All the perks of the stick but waaay more powerful and has voice search
